WebOn March 16, 2024, at 23:36 JST, a strong earthquake struck off the coast of Fukushima, Japan. [7] The earthquake had a magnitude of 7.4 according to the Japanese Meteorological Agency (JMA), while the United States Geological Survey (USGS) gave an estimate of 7.3. Immediately after the event a 30‑cm tsunami was reported.
